Output e9904db3fe7dc4061f6988a04dac318b8971cf747a38e684e653bcd519762757:3

value
3936200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2095f032abfab80ab85477c2d4bf61eb5925e990 OP_EQUAL
address
34fKAaNYYfPTKeopF2U7t7WgLmJCdPAJHg
transaction
e9904db3fe7dc4061f6988a04dac318b8971cf747a38e684e653bcd519762757
spent
true